‘Friday’ Propels Ice Cube Locally

While Santana parlayed last week’s multiple Grammy nominations into a return to No. 1 on the national and Southern California album sales charts, Ice Cube used his West Coast credentials to break into the local Top 10 with the soundtrack to his new comedy, “Next Friday.” The collection is powered by Cube’s own hit “You Can Do It” and the reunion of his original group N.W.A--whose Dr. Dre and Snoop Dogg also register on their own on the album and singles charts.
TOP 10 ALBUMS
Title, Artist (Nat’l Rank): Last Week
1 Supernatural, Santana (1): 5
2 Dr. Dre 2001, Dr. Dre (7): 1
3 All the Way--A Decade of Song, Celine Dion (4): 6
4 Life & Times of S. Carter, Jay-Z (2): 2
5 Christina Aguilera, Christina Aguilera (6): 8
6 Still I Rise, 2Pac + Outlawz (8): 4
7 And Then There Was X, DMX (3): 3
8 Next Friday, soundtrack (34): 15
9 Enema of the State, Blink-182 (16): 7
10 Now 3, various artists (5): 12
TOP 10 SINGLES
Title, Artist (Nat’l Rank): Last Week
1 What a Girl Wants, Christina Aguilera (1): 1
2 I Knew I Loved You, Savage Garden (2): --
3 You Can Do It, Ice Cube (11): 4
4 G’d Up, Snoop Dogg Pres. Tha Eastsidaz (18): 6
5 Girl on TV, LFO (6): 2
6 Smooth, Santana (7): 10
7 Caught Out There, Kelis (12): 12
8 I Wanna Love You Forever, Jessica Simpson (4): 5
9 Hot Boyz, Missy Elliott (3): 7
10 Auld Lang Syne (Millennium Mix), Kenny G (8): 3
Source: SoundScan Inc., for week ended Jan. 9
